I am running the latest Microsoft Edge Beta Version 78.0.276.11 (Official build) beta (64-bit). For the past few days I haved noticed that when I launch the browser, the browser is opening with the page or pages I had opened when I last closed the browser, plus the page I have set to open in the browsers startup settings. Hi there,
That's a known bug that I also had experienced at some point when I was on version 78. (now i'm using Canary version 79), unfortunately there was nothing much I could do about it but waiting.

Anyhow, please check a few things to make sure it is indeed that bug and not something else

1. when you close your Edge insider browser window(s), do you still see Edge insider icon on the notification area? (bottom-right corner of the screen) ?
2. do you use any PWA (progressive web apps)? such as pinning a website as an app to the taskbar or start menu and then use it separately?

both of the things I mentioned could be potential reasons for that behavior,
and lastly, try turning off  " Continue running background apps when Microsoft Edge is closed"


in here: edge://settings/system

and see if it makes any difference.

Yes, previously I talked to one of the Edge developers here and he said that to prevent what you are experiencing (open tabs coming back), I should either get rid of the extension keeping the Edge open or uncheck the option that lets Edge run in the background.

the way I see it, the best way to keep using that extension and also preventing that behavior from happening is to uncheck option "let Microsoft Edge run in the background"
